Description
Mary’s Center, founded in 1988, is a Federally Qualified Health Center that provides health care, family literacy and social services to 24,000 individuals whose needs too often go unmet by the public and private systems.

Program areas at Mary's Center

Patient services: Mary's Center health promotion department provides health education and health promotion on nutrition and healthy lifestyles, sexual health, prevention, management, and navigation of cancer, cardiovascular diseases, diabetes, tobacco use, asthma, and hiv/stis. Mary's Center's health promotion department develops programs that help patients understand the social ecological model (sem), a model grounded on the understanding that people and their environment influence each other. Applying this framework to behavior change interventions allows us to engage with individuals, organizations, and the greater community to find meaningful solutions to complex medical, social and educational challenges faced by the community we serve. The sem, prevalent in public health program planning since the late 1970s and credited to urie brofenbrenneris, is the framework in which the health promotion department at Mary's Center was founded. Services are provided both onsite and through outreach events in the community, such as health fairs. Demonstrating the success of our model and committed team, our health exchange navigators and assisters continue to help thousands of individuals enroll in the health insurance marketplace in the district of columbia and Maryland. Medical services: Mary's Center offers full clinical Care for all stages of life including: the provision of prenatal and postnatal Care sonography capabilities and telemedicine to take into the community to assess clients wherever is most convenient, thereby preventing hospitalization and unnecessary use of emergency rooms and pediatric Care and primary Care for the entire family, including services for the geriatric patient. Our primary Care services include physical exams, family planning, vaccinations, and chronic illness medical management. Our mental health services include diagnosis, assessment, counseling, case management, prescription, and monitoring of somatic medications. Substance abuse screenings, referrals, and postdetox counseling are also available. Mary's Center also provides covid19 vaccines, testing and treatment. All services are provided in the language of the patient, and the three lines of service are integrated for efficiency and effectiveness in a patient-centered medical home model. Social and educational services: Mary's Center provides adolescent education and supportive services, in home visits to families and their children, comprehensive and integrated behavioral health services, and parental educational services with the goal of increasing the economic opportunities for those that seek our services. Mary's Center implements a holistic approach to health Care and recognizes that in addition to ensuring the physical health of our families, we must also work to ensure their social and emotional health. Stressors that impact social and emotional health can adversely impact an individual's ability to access services and contribute to somatic concerns that necessitate medical visits. Our holistic model has proven successful again this year: 100% of our adolescents in the afterschool teen program avoided teen pregnancy and 100% of the high school seniors were accepted into college. Most of these teens are the first in their families to graduate high school.
Briya public charter school: Mary's Center's partner in education, briya public charter school, works with our participants to provide language classes, job training, & early childhood development for families in Washington, dc. Our unique two-generation model includes: early childhood education for children six weeks through five years old, adult education basic through advanced english classes for immigrant parents, the national external diploma program, and workforce development programs. Family integration, consisting of Child development lessons and co-education times for parents and their young children.
